THE GOOD NEWS
The Mean Green returns its two leading scorers, freshman G Josh White, the Sun Belt Freshman of the Year, and junior G Collin Dennis, the conference Newcomer of the Year, and junior F Adam McCoy showed some promising signs late in the season.

THE BAD NEWS
The Mean Green has a lot of work to do to replace starting Fs Quincy Williams and Keith Wooden.

KEY RETURNEES
Gs Josh White, Collin Dennis and Collin Mangrum, and Fs Harold Stewart, Kedrick Hogans, Justin Howerton and Adam McCoy.

ROSTER REPORT

--G Josh White, a 5-10, 167-pound freshman, turned out to be a real find, earning Sun Belt Freshman of the Year honors by scoring a team-high 13.9 points per game and a conference-best .458 shooting percentage from 3-point range.

--Collin Dennis, a transfer from South Florida in his first season with the Mean Green, earned Sun Belt Newcomer of the Year honors by scoring 13.6 points per game and finishing fifth in the Sun Belt in 3-point shooting percentage at .421.

--The Mean Green had high hopes for Adam McCoy when he came to UNT out of junior college, but those expectations didn't start to pan out until late in the season. McCoy averaged only 5.3 points per game but he scored in double figures in two of the last four games, including 21 points on eight of eight shooting in the first round of the Sun Belt tournament against Arkansas State.

--UNT is counting on the return of sophomore G Collin Mangrum, who played a significant role off the bench for the Mean Green as a freshman during its run to the NCAA but sat out the 2007-08 season following knee surgery.
